The situation this course is for
Even skilled compliance officers struggle when regulations shift quickly and stakeholders expect faster turnaround. Without a standardized, transparent operating model, efforts become siloed, evidence is scattered, and audit prep turns into crisis mode. This erodes trust and limits influence.
